We are seeking a Logistics Analyst IV / Medical Liaison to provide support to the Project Manager Soldier Medical Devices (PM SMD), Force Integration Division (FID) in providing Medical Materiel Support to all Army components facilitating optimal healthcare and worldwide medical readiness at Fort Cavazos.

So, what will the Logistics Analyst IV / Medical Liaison at Terrestris do?
As the Logistics Analyst IV / Medical Liaison, you will provide comprehensive medical logistics support to various Army units. This role involves coordinating medical sustainment operations, managing medical materiel, and ensuring optimal healthcare readiness. You will work closely with the Program Executive Office Soldier, Project Manager Soldier Medical Devices, and other key stakeholders to facilitate the delivery of medical sustainment technical guidance and support.
